England's thrilling victory over Mexico at the 2026 World Cup was marked by a lot of determination and determination. At the iconic Azteca Stadium, the English team won 3-2 in an adrenaline-filled game, thus guaranteeing qualification for the quarter-finals of the tournament. Striker Harry Kane, visibly exhausted after the match, expressed his joy at the victory: "The team found a way to overcome the difficulties. It was an incredible night for us." England started the game on the right foot, with Jude Bellingham shining by scoring two goals in just a few minutes. However, the Mexican team was undeterred and managed to cash in, making the game even more exciting. Despite seeing his team down a player, with the expulsion of Jarell Quansah, Kane converted a crucial penalty that proved decisive in the final result. Coach Thomas Tuchel praised the team, stating that the victory was the result of pure will and determination. "If any team has heart and belief, it's England. We overcame a lot of adversity and I'm very proud of what we did today. The tense atmosphere and pressure at the Azteca Stadium, known for its altitude and the massive support of the Mexican fans, made England's victory even more special. Goalkeeper Jordan Pickford played a key role in the defense, making key saves that secured the victory. "Playing here is something unique, a memory that I will keep forever. You have to roll up your sleeves and fight," said Pickford, highlighting the team's determination. Former players such as Wayne Rooney highlighted the importance of the victory, reinforcing that the team showed attitude, determination and desire, characteristics that could lead England to win the long-awaited second world title. However, the team still has a long way to go, with their next challenge being against Norway, where they will face top scorer Erling Haaland, who has already scored seven goals in the tournament and is a constant threat. "We still have a long way to go.
